How to replace the accessory drivebelt
My car is at the dealership. One of the things they noticed is the drivebelt needs to be replaced. They want $150.
I can get the two belts from Napa for $30 - how difficult is this to do myself?

Its easy. Just like doing an UDP install without the UDP.
Jack the car up, remove the passenger wheel and the black plastic shield behind it. Look under the hood and loosen the nut/bolt on the tensioner pulley. Then turn the tensioner nut to get the belt as loose as possible. Remove belt, put new one in. Do the previous things in reverse now.
